Percentage of enrolment in primary education in public institutions in Cambodia
Cambodia: Percentage of enrolment in primary education in public institutions was 48.0% in 2019. ▲ Rising
Percentage of enrolment in primary education in public institutions in Cambodia, 1999–2019
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
In 2019, percentage of enrolment in primary education in public institutions in Cambodia stood at 48.0%.
The figure is down 0.2% on the previous year and up 1.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, percentage of enrolment in primary education in public institutions in Cambodia peaked at 49.0% in 2015 and was at its lowest, 45.7%, in 1999.
That places Cambodia 162nd out of 200 countries with data for 2019,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 21 years of available data.
Percentage of enrolment in primary education in public institutions in Cambodia,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1999 | 45.7% | — |
| 2000 | 45.8% | +0.3% |
| 2001 | 46.2% | +0.9% |
| 2002 | 46.5% | +0.5% |
| 2003 | 46.7% | +0.5% |
| 2004 | 47.0% | +0.6% |
| 2005 | 47.2% | +0.5% |
| 2006 | 47.3% | +0.1% |
| 2007 | 47.2% | -0.1% |
| 2008 | 47.4% | +0.3% |
| 2009 | 47.4% | +0.1% |
| 2010 | 47.8% | +0.7% |
| 2011 | 47.6% | -0.3% |
| 2012 | 47.7% | +0.1% |
| 2013 | 47.1% | -1.2% |
| 2014 | 48.0% | +1.9% |
| 2015 | 49.0% | +2.2% |
| 2016 | 48.3% | -1.4% |
| 2017 | 48.2% | -0.3% |
| 2018 | 48.1% | -0.2% |
| 2019 | 48.0% | -0.2% |
